Replacement and upgrade for a broken voilamart controller. This puts out more power, enough to notice it from standing start and it's a bit quieter and smoother due to the sine wave upgrade.Once you have the wiring diagram you will figure it out. It has a plug for immobilizer and it comes immobilized so you have to remove that pink jumper wire or the display won't turn on. It also comes with a blue jumper wire that prevents you from changing the program settings, so you have remove that before you can program it. It included instructions for the KT LCD3 display but you can also watch YT videos on it. I took it for a quick spin am just finishing setting it up now. Good price for what you get.EDIT: the only issue I have with this controller is the throttle lag. There is no lag if stopped but the faster you are going the longer it takes for the voltage signal to build up to the current speed which creates a lag when you give it throttle at speed. There are lots of posts on different ebikes that have this same problem. It is the way the controller is designed. It takes more advanced programming to have both smooth low speed operation and immediate high speed torque. Basic kits use a different kind of throttle control that makes start up a bit jerky but gives you instant torque at any speed. More powerful controllers can't use that method as it would be too jerky at start up. People have used diy arduino modules to intercept and modify the throttle signal for custom tuning to make it better. And the Cycle Analyst also can do this but is expensive and complicated. So as it is you can't do rolling wheelies or lift the front end for a log while moving. You will be over the obstacle before the throttle kicks in. On the road a half second or second delay doesn't matter, it comes on nice an smooth and is fine but it is a bummer on a mountain bike. If anyone knows of a cheap solution, please reply. Or a cheap controller that has better throttle control. I can live with it but it takes half the fun out of riding my e-mountain bike.

This is a great product. I upgraded my 48V 1000W based ebike with this 48V 1500W kit. With this KT controller, my trike accelerates much faster, and the motor now runs quiet. The kit is very complete, even includes the a connector block for the motor phase wires, and the battery power connector pair. The included LCD3 display panel has many features and adjustments. Ask the seller for the controller documentation. I didn't ask for, but found the LCD3 documentation with a quick google search. The controller accessories were plug compatible with my older components (PAS, brakes, throttle).
